< 5 > Replacement of Clutch Drum and Brake Spring (cont.)

3. Take Brake spring out of Gear housing (R), then remove Brake spring from the claw of Brake spring holder. (Fig. 12)

<6 > Replacement of Brake Spring Holder

1.First lock Clutch drum with Brake spring using Retaining ring S pliers (1R003) as described below. Place the jaws of the pliers as illustrated in Fig. 13.

Open the pliers until Brake spring holder is locked in the position as illustrated in Fig. 13. Now clutch drum is locked with Brake spring.

2.Inert one jaw of Retaining ring R pliers (No.1R005) into the hole of Brake spring holder, and the other jaw into Compression spring 9 as illustrated in Fig. 14.

By closing the pliers, Compression spring 9 can be removed from Gear housing (R).

3.By removing Clamp washer using a slotted screwdriver or the like, Blake spring holder can be replaced. (Fig. 15) Note: Do not reuse a Clamp washer removed from Gear housing (R). Always use brand-new one.
